When selecting a circuit breaker, two critical metrics define its ruggedness: the Ultimate Short-Circuit Breaking Capacity (Icu) and the Service Short-Circuit Breaking Capacity (Ics). Measured in kiloamperes (kA), these parameters dictate the maximum fault current the device can safely interrupt without destruction.
Acereare Electric specializes in producing circuit breakers with high breaking capacities reaching up to 200kA. Our proprietary contact systems utilize electromagnetic repulsion forces to accelerate contact separation under fault conditions. Keeping Ics = 100% Icu ensures the circuit breaker remains fully functional even after interrupting a heavy short circuit, providing robust operational reliability to utilities and critical factories worldwide.

Acereare electrical protection systems are engineered to withstand extreme physical and environmental demands.
Built with low-temperature resistant structural materials, specialized low-temperature lubricants, and thickened protective plating, our breakers operate safely at temperatures down to -40°C.
Tested for up to 72 hours on full assemblies and 48 hours on components. These MCCBs resist corrosion in marine environments, coastal docks, and offshore power systems.
For installations exceeding 2,000 meters, we provide detailed derating guides. Adjustments account for lower air density to ensure reliable insulation performance and cooling.
